Deprince Race & Zollo Inc. Sells 80,633 Shares of General Motors (NYSE:GM)

Deprince Race & Zollo Inc. trimmed its position in shares of General Motors (NYSE:GMFree Report) (TSE:GMM.U) by 11.9% during the 2nd quarter, according to its most recent 13F filing with the SEC. The fund owned 594,649 shares of the auto manufacturer’s stock after selling 80,633 shares during the quarter. Deprince Race & Zollo Inc.’s holdings in General Motors were worth $27,627,000 at the end of the most recent reporting period.

General Motors (NYSE:GMGet Free Report) (TSE:GMM.U) last announced its quarterly earnings data on Tuesday, July 23rd. The auto manufacturer reported $3.06 earnings per share for the quarter, beating the consensus estimate of $2.67 by $0.39. The business had revenue of $47.97 billion during the quarter, compared to analyst estimates of $45.13 billion. General Motors had a return on equity of 15.77% and a net margin of 6.22%. General Motors’s revenue was up 7.2% compared to the same quarter last year. During the same period in the prior year, the company earned $1.91 earnings per share. On average, research analysts expect that General Motors will post 9.95 earnings per share for the current fiscal year.

General Motors announced that its Board of Directors has approved a stock repurchase plan on Tuesday, June 11th that allows the company to repurchase $6.00 billion in outstanding shares. This repurchase authorization allows the auto manufacturer to repurchase up to 10.8% of its shares through open market purchases. General Motors Profile

(Free Report)

General Motors Company designs, builds, and sells trucks, crossovers, cars, and automobile parts; and provide software-enabled services and subscriptions worldwide. The company operates through GM North America, GM International, Cruise, and GM Financial segments. It markets its vehicles primarily under the Buick, Cadillac, Chevrolet, GMC, Baojun, and Wuling brand names.
